Understanding the Fundamentals of Prediction Markets

Prediction markets, at their heart, function similarly to traditional markets but focus on the probability of events occurring. Instead of trading stocks representing company ownership, users trade contracts representing the likelihood of a specific outcome. The price of these contracts reflects the collective wisdom of the participants, effectively creating a forecast of future events. This mechanism can be remarkably accurate, often outperforming traditional polling and expert opinions. The beauty of prediction markets lies in their ability to aggregate information from a wide range of sources and distill it into a single, quantifiable metric. kalshi, in particular, operates within a regulated framework, adding a layer of security and transparency that is often lacking in less formal prediction platforms.

The potential applications of prediction markets are vast, spanning political events, economic indicators, and even the success of new products. By accurately predicting outcomes, these markets can provide valuable insights for businesses, policymakers, and individuals alike. For example, a prediction market could forecast the outcome of an election, the direction of the stock market, or the likelihood of a natural disaster. These insights can then be used to make more informed decisions and mitigate potential risks. The real-time nature of these markets also means that predictions can be updated as new information becomes available, offering a dynamic and responsive forecasting tool.

Regulatory Landscape and Compliance

The regulatory environment surrounding prediction markets is evolving rapidly. As these platforms gain prominence, regulators are grappling with how to classify and oversee them. In the United States, the Commodity Futures Trading Commission (CFTC) has asserted jurisdiction over certain prediction markets, requiring platforms to comply with specific regulations. These regulations are designed to protect investors, prevent market manipulation, and ensure the integrity of the trading process. Navigating this regulatory landscape can be complex, and platforms like kalshi must invest significant resources in compliance efforts. This includes implementing robust know-your-customer (KYC) procedures, anti-money laundering (AML) controls, and risk management systems.

The increasing regulatory scrutiny reflects a growing recognition of the potential impact of prediction markets on financial stability and market confidence. While the benefits of these markets are clear, regulators are cautious about the risks of fraud, manipulation, and illegal trading activities. Platforms must demonstrate a commitment to responsible innovation and a willingness to cooperate with regulators to ensure a safe and fair trading environment. Transparency and accountability are key principles that underpin effective regulation. Clear disclosure requirements, independent audits, and robust enforcement mechanisms are essential to maintaining market integrity.

The Future of Prediction Markets and Technological Advancements

The future of prediction markets is inextricably linked to advancements in technology, particularly in the areas of artificial intelligence (AI) and blockchain. AI can be used to enhance data analysis, improve predictive modeling, and automate trading strategies. Machine learning algorithms can identify patterns and relationships in data that humans might miss, leading to more accurate predictions. Blockchain technology can provide a secure and transparent infrastructure for trading, reducing the risk of fraud and manipulation. The use of smart contracts can automate the execution of trades and ensure that outcomes are settled fairly and efficiently. These technological innovations have the potential to further democratize access to prediction markets and make them more accessible to a wider range of participants.

Furthermore, the integration of prediction markets with other financial instruments is likely to become more common. For example, prediction market contracts could be used as collateral for loans or as underlying assets for derivatives. This integration could create new investment opportunities and enhance market liquidity. The development of decentralized prediction markets, built on blockchain technology, could also disrupt the traditional market structure and introduce new levels of transparency and efficiency. The use of oracles, which provide real-world data to smart contracts, is crucial for ensuring the accuracy and reliability of decentralized prediction markets.

The Role of Decentralized Finance (DeFi)

Decentralized finance (DeFi) offers a compelling vision for the future of prediction markets. By leveraging blockchain technology, DeFi platforms can create permissionless and transparent prediction markets that are not subject to the control of any central authority. This can reduce the risk of censorship and manipulation and increase access for users around the world. DeFi platforms can also offer innovative features such as decentralized governance, where users can participate in the decision-making process of the platform. However, DeFi platforms also come with their own set of risks, including smart contract vulnerabilities, impermanent loss, and regulatory uncertainty.

The success of DeFi prediction markets will depend on addressing these risks and building robust and secure infrastructure. The development of standardized smart contract templates and security auditing tools is crucial for mitigating the risk of vulnerabilities. Clear regulatory guidelines are also needed to provide legal certainty and encourage responsible innovation. The integration of DeFi prediction markets with traditional financial systems could unlock significant new opportunities and accelerate the adoption of this technology.
